Understanding Bingo Halls in the UK
Bingo halls have long been a staple of British people social culture, offering a unique portmanteau word of entertainment and community spirit. In the UK, these establishments are regulated by the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), ensuring a safe and fair surround for players. The traditional game selection of bingo, often associated with small stakes and friendly rivalry, has evolved to include electronic bingo terminals and digital interfaces, yet the core experience remains centred around the communal aspect. Players typically purchase printed tickets or use electronic dabbers to mark numbers as they are called out, with the aim of completing a specific pattern to win a prize. Modern bingo halls often feature bars, restaurants, and live entertainment, making them a destination for social outings. The UKGC mandates strict age verification (18+), responsible gambling measures, and transparentness in award distribution, which are all critical to maintaining trust. For those latest to the scene, it is advisable to start with a small budget, translate the rules of each game variant (such as 90-ball or 75-ball bingo), and avoid chasing losses. Bingo halls in the UK also support local charities through dedicated charity bingo nights, contributing to community welfare. The social aspect is a tonality draw, with players often forming friendships and attending regularly. However, as with any form of gambling, it is important to set limits and recognise when play ceases to be fun. The UKGC’s resources, such as GamCare and GamStop, provide back for those who may develop problem gambling behaviours. Overall, bingo halls offer a regulated, low-stakes gambling option that prioritises social interaction and entertainment.

The Rise of Online Bingo Sites
Online bingo has experienced significant ontogenesis in the UK, especially since the early 2000s, with digital platforms replicating the social experience of physical halls while adding convenience and variety. UKGC-licensed online bingo sites are now a major segment of the non-branded gambling market place, offering a widely range of games including 90-ball, 80-ball, 75-ball, and fastness bingo. These platforms often incorporated chat rooms, themed rooms, and progressive jackpots to heighten player engagement. Unlike land-based bingo, online versions allow players to purchase tickets in advance, participate in multiple games simultaneously, and get to promotions such as deposit bonuses, free tickets, and loyalty rewards. The legal framework in the UK requires these sites to implement robust age verification, self-exclusion tools, and deposit limits to promote responsible gambling. Players can enjoy bingo on desktop and mobile devices, with apps providing unlined gameplay and notifications for upcoming games. The social component remains entire, with chat moderators (often called ‘callers’) interacting with players and facilitating community events. Yet, players should be cautious of unlicensed operators that may not adhere to UKGC standards. Always check for the UKGC logo and verify the licence figure on the regulator’s website. Online bingo also offers let down minimum stakes compared to some other forms of gambling, making it accessible to a broader audience. For those interested in trying online bingo, it is recommended to go through the terms and conditions carefully, especially regarding wagering requirements on bonuses. The variety of games and the ability to play from home have made online bingo a popular choice, but it is essential to maintain a balanced come on and avoid excessive play.
Bingo Strategies and Tips for UK Players
While bingo is largely a game of chance, players can take up certain strategies to enhance their experience and potentially improve their odds. Ace in effect approach is to manage the figure of tickets purchased per game; buying more tickets increases the chance of winning but also raises the cost. A usual tip is to play during off-peak times when fewer players are fighting, which can reduce competition for prizes. In online bingo, choosing games with lower ticket prices or smaller jackpots often results in better odds, as these games tend to have fewer participants. Another strategy is to focus on pattern-based games, such as those requiring a specific configuration (e.g., letter X or T), as these can end quickly and offer higher chances of a win. Steady players often track their spending and set a strict budget, avoiding the temptation to tag losses. It is also beneficial to take advantage of free tickets and no-deposit bonuses offered by UKGC-licensed bingo sites, which allow practice without financial risk. For land-based bingo, arriving early to secure a goodness seat and infer the session schedule can improve the experience.

The Regulatory Framework and Your Rights
Understanding the regulatory context is crucial for anyone engaging in non-brand gambling in the UK. While the Gambling Act 2005 and subsequent amendments give the foundation for licensing and regulation, many forms of non-brand gambling exist in a grey area or are explicitly free from certain requirements. For instance, small-scale private lotteries, certain types of value competitions, and free draws may not require a UKGC licence provided they meet specific conditions, such as limits on fine prices and prize values. However, this does not mean they are unregulated; they may be subject to other laws, such as the Lotteries and Amusements Act or consumer trade protection legislating. As a participant, you have rights under UK practice of law, including the right to fair handling, transparent rules, and resort if something goes wrong. Always be after clear terms and conditions, and be wary of any scheme that seems vague or overly secretive about how it operates. In 2026, the UK government continues to review gambling legislation to address emerging challenges, specially in the digital space. This ongoing scrutiny agency that the rules governing non-brand gambling may change, potentially bringing more activities under formal regulation. Staying abreast of these developments can help you anticipate how your favourite pastimes mightiness be affected. Moreover, if you ever feel that you have been treated unfairly or that an organiser has acted dishonestly, you have got options. Depending on the nature of the government issue, you might report it to the UKGC (if the activity falls within its remand), Trading Standards, or even the constabulary in cases of dupery. For disputes involving small amounts, alternative difference resolve services or small claims court may be seize. The key is to document everything: keep records of payments, communications, and any promotional materials. By knowing your rights and the regulatory landscape, you authorise yourself to participate with confidence and hold organisers accountable when necessary.
Practical Tips for Safe Participation
To make the most of non-brand gambling while minimising risks, debate adopting a localise of practical habits that will serve you fountainhead across all activities. First and foremost, always conduct basic search before committing money. For online platforms, look for independent reviews, check if the site provides verifiable contact entropy, and search for any history of complaints. For offline events like raffles or tombolas, inquire the organiser about the intent of the event and how proceeds are distributed—legitimate charity events will usually be transparent about their beneficiaries. Endorse, set a strict budget for your gambling activities and do by it as an entertainment expense, not an investment funds. Decide in advance how practically you are willing to spend and stop once that limit point is reached, regardless of whether you are winning or losing. Tertiary, be mindful of the time you devote to gambling. It can be easygoing to lose track of time, especially with engaging online platforms, so use alarms or app timers to keep yourself in check. Fourth, never take a chance under the act upon of alcohol or other substances that impair your judgment. Fifth, involve a trusted friend or family member in your gambling decisions; talking openly about your activities can provide an external perspective and help you stay accountable. Sixth, benefit from of any tools offered by platforms, such as deposit limits, self-exclusion options, or reality checks. Fifty-fifty if a non-brand platform does not supply these features, you can implement your own versions, such as using a pre-paid card with a set balance. Seventh, civilize yourself about the specific odds and probabilities of the games you play. Many non-brand activities, such as skill-based competitions, give improve odds than purely chance-based games, but understanding the math can help you make believe smarter choices. Finally, call up that gambling should never be a way to piddle money or solve financial problems. If you find yourself chasing losses or feeling anxious about your gambling, it may be time to step back and seek support. Organisations same GamCare, BeGambleAware, and the National Gambling Helpline present free, confidential advice and resources for anyone affected by gambling-related harm. By integrating these practices into your routine, you can enjoy the unique pleasures of non-brand gambling while safeguarding your well-being.
